If hand sanitizer kills 99.9% of germs, what stops us from using that all of the time instead of hand washing?

Sanitisers and cleaners are two entirely different things.

A sanitiser will kill bacteria and viruses.

A cleaner (such as soap) will remove dirt and grease.
